Business Systems Analysis Manager jobs in Brentwood, NY

Business Systems Analysis Manager manages a team of analysts responsible for the analysis of new business system development and existing system improvement. Allocates analysis team resources and monitors deliverables to ensure client needs are met successfully and in a timely fashion. Being a Business Systems Analysis Manager builds test plans and data. Coordinates with other teams to identify and implement new systems to support business function at effective cost. Additionally, Business Systems Analysis Manager requ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a head of a unit/department. The Business Systems Analysis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. Extensive knowledge of department processes. To be a Business Systems Analysis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 to 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Brentwood is a hamlet in the Town of Islip in Suffolk County, New York, United States. As of the 2010 Census, the population of Brentwood was 60,664. Brentwood is located at 40°46′54″N 73°14′39″W / 40.78167°N 73.24417°W / 40.78167; -73.24417 (40.781805, −73.244060). According to the United States Census Bureau, the CDP has a total area of 10.1 square miles (26.1 km²).[citation needed]...
